## Add waveform preview to clip uploader

This PR adds a canvas-based waveform preview to the Tollbrook clip uploader. Decoding happens in a worker so the UI thread stays responsive; we downsample to a fixed bucket count and cache peaks per clip. Long files are truncated at the preview window rather than fully decoded — worth knowing before you touch the decoder. Rendering parameters are centralized in one module so nothing is hardcoded in components. The constants shipped in this change are listed here.

limits module of fajog-tawig:
RATE_LIMITS = {
    "druwyn": 2,
    "quenael": 10,
    "wenix": 2,
    "druael": 2,
}

## Deployment

The FuelLedger report service generates nightly fuel-usage summaries for the Brackenvale delivery fleet. Deploys go through the standard Ostermill pipeline: merge to main, wait for the canary stage, then promote. The service reads all tunables from its environment at startup, so config changes require a restart, not a rebuild. New team members should deploy to staging at least once before touching prod. The baseline configuration used in both environments is listed below.

settings of yahaf-tahop:
jorox:
  pin: 5851
  tenant: noveth
  seal: seal_7ddb5c42
  metrics_host: metrics.jorox.ordinnet.example
  standby_team: wenax
  escalation: oliath-feneth
  nonce: 552548

## Session Handling for Health Checks

The Corvel gateway sits behind the Lanternside load balancer, which probes /healthz every ten seconds. Health-check requests are stateless by design: they bypass the session store entirely so that probe traffic never inflates session counts or evicts real user sessions. New team members should note that the deep-check endpoint, /healthz/deep, does verify session-store connectivity and therefore requires authentication. When probing it manually, supply the token below.

bearer token for tajep-kajef: eyJhbGciOiJIUzI1NiIsInR5cCI6IkpXVCJ9.eyJzdWIiOiIoOsZ23In0.CsygO0hs